hello there,

anyone knows any reasons why my DVD/CD-W stoped writing cds?....can read perfectly but nor write...when burning a cd all seems ok but when i try to read it there is nothing in the cd. :(

Thanks In advance

Have you tried the cd's in another machine?

Have the drivers been update recently if you then maybe try rolling them back or if no try updating them.

Else it is probably a physical fault - Is the machine under warranty?

A new DVD R/W isn't that expensive and would probably solve it - if a new one it doesn't solve it then you can always get a refund and maybe look to see if it's a deeper configuration issue or maybe your graphics card.
